HB 305 Unlawful Detention by a Transient Occupant (2015 Session)
Harrison Co Sponsors: Adkins, Albritton, Broxson, Edwards-Walpole CS Sponsors: Judiciary Committee, Civil Justice Subcommittee
Unlawful Detention by a Transient Occupant: Defines "transient occupant"; provides factors that establish transient occupancy; provides for removal of transient occupant by law enforcement officer; provides cause of action for wrongful removal; limits actions for wrongful removal; provides civil action for removal of transient occupant. Effective Date: July 1, 2015
